Role Overview
As Data Architect you will take full ownership of the company’s overall data architecture & infrastructure and will work strategically to manage how data is structured, integrated and governed throughout the business.
You will be responsible for defining the data architecture roadmap across platforms and systems, including Salesforce & supporting applications, Azure Cloud and a broad range of SaaS & other cloud based solutions.
You will leverage BI tools and will ensure that data is accessible, accurate, secure and aligned with business goals.
Responsibilities
- Design, implement and optimise the enterprise-wide data architecture
- Define and enforce data standards, principles, and best practices
- Develop and maintain logical and physical data models, ensuring alignment
- Lead the assessment and implementation of data architecture improvements
- Oversee the development, maintenance, and optimization of business intelligence
- Ensure dashboards and reports are accurate & performant
- Define and manage data pipelines, semantic models, and data transformations
- Understand and oversee the data architecture of Salesforce
- Define strategies for Salesforce data extraction, transformation, and loading
- Implement and optimize data pipelines and orchestration tools within Azure
- Ensure cloud-based data infrastructure is secure, scalable, and cost-efficient
- Define and enforce data governance frameworks
- Act as the primary liaison between data architecture and business stakeholders
- Manage relationships with external data providers and vendors
Candidate Requirements
- Proven experience as a Data Architect, BI Architect, or similar
- Familiarity with MuleSoft or other ETL/integration platforms
- Strong hands-on expertise in Power BI, data modelling, and performance optimisation
- Deep understanding of Salesforce data structures and integrations
- Proficiency in Azure data services
- Experience designing and implementing data pipelines, data lakes, and warehouses
- Strong knowledge of data governance, security, and compliance frameworks
- Experience with master data management (MDM) and metadata
